Introduction
The Canon I-SENSYS MF655CDW is a compact and versatile 3-in-1 colour laser multifunction printer. Having used it extensively for several weeks in both home and a small office environment, I’m ready to share my in-depth review. This review will cover its performance, features, ease of use, and overall value.
Features
The MF655CDW boasts a compelling array of features, making it suitable for a range of users. Key features include automatic duplex printing (a significant time-saver!), a user-friendly touchscreen interface, and excellent mobile connectivity options. The ability to print from both iOS and Android devices using a variety of apps is a major plus, eliminating the need for complex setup.
I particularly appreciated the intuitive control panel; navigating through the settings and performing tasks like scanning to email were remarkably straightforward. The paper handling, while limited to a 100-sheet output tray, is sufficient for most small-office and home-office printing needs. For larger print jobs, this might necessitate more frequent paper replenishment, but it’s certainly manageable.
Performance
Print speed is impressive, averaging around the advertised 21ppm for simplex printing. Duplex printing speed, as expected, is slower but still respectable. Print quality is consistently sharp and clear, even with more complex graphics and images. The scan and copy functions worked flawlessly, producing crisp, accurate copies. I tested the printer with a variety of document types, including text-heavy reports, colourful presentations, and photographs, and consistently obtained excellent results.
The wireless connectivity was robust and reliable, with no noticeable dropouts or connection issues during my testing. Setup was straightforward; connecting to my Wi-Fi network was a breeze. I experienced minimal wait times for prints to complete.
While the printer is relatively quiet compared to some inkjet alternatives, it is definitely not silent. In a quiet office environment, it could be noticeable.
Pros & Cons
Pros:
- Fast print speeds
- Excellent print quality
- Easy setup and intuitive interface
- Robust wireless connectivity
- Automatic duplex printing
- Versatile mobile printing options
Cons:
- Small paper output tray (100 sheets)
- Not completely silent during operation
- Slightly more expensive than some comparable models
